SUMMARY
If there is more than one display connected, opening a window on login without
having moved the mouse at all on login before, the window will open on the
wrong display. This can be replicated by logging in without moving a mouse, and
using a shortcut (such as Ctrl+Alt+T) to open a window (such as Konsole).

On my setup, pressing Ctrl+Alt+T to open Konsole in this scenario opens the
window on my top-lost display instead of the display that the cursor is on,
which is the center of my primary display (bottom left on my physical setup).

This does not occur if only one display is present. 

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Login without moving the mouse.
2. Open a window, such as via a keyboard shortcut.
3. The window will open on the wrong display.

OBSERVED RESULT
Windows open on the wrong display when opened without moving the mouse since
logging in.

EXPECTED RESULT
Windows should open on the display the cursor is on, even if the mouse has
never been moved.

SOFTWARE/OS VERSIONS
Operating System: Arch Linux 
KDE Plasma Version: 6.3.2
KDE Frameworks Version: 6.11.0
Qt Version: 6.8.2
Graphics Platform: Wayland

ADDITIONAL INFORMATION
Unsure if this occurs on X11.
